South-facing solar panels typically yield the highest energy production, while east-west facing roofs can still be effective. Most roof tilts will work well, with a few exceptions. Most homeowners need between 15-25 solar panels to power their entire home, but this number varies significantly based on your energy usage, location, and roof characteristics.
